How To Install opencl-filesystem on Fedora 36

In this tutorial we learn how to install opencl-filesystem in Fedora 36. opencl-filesystem is OpenCL filesystem layout

Introduction

In this tutorial we learn how to install opencl-filesystem on Fedora 36.

What is opencl-filesystem

This package provides some directories required by packages which use OpenCL.

We can use yum or dnf to install opencl-filesystem on Fedora 36. In this tutorial we discuss both methods but you only need to choose one of method to install opencl-filesystem.

Install opencl-filesystem on Fedora 36 Using dnf

Update yum database with dnf using the following command.

sudo dnf makecache --refresh

After updating yum database, We can install opencl-filesystem using dnf by running the following command:

sudo dnf -y install opencl-filesystem

How To Uninstall opencl-filesystem on Fedora 36

To uninstall only the opencl-filesystem package we can use the following command:

sudo dnf remove opencl-filesystem

opencl-filesystem Package Contents on Fedora 36

/etc/OpenCL
/etc/OpenCL/vendors
